Immersive Gameplay

  • Author: Jacomel
  • Download Size: 2.64 MB
  • DLC Required: None / Automatron + Far Harbor + Nuka World [Two versions of the mod are available.]

[Note: Always place this mod at the end of your load order.]

The largest gameplay and difficulty mod available for console is now available on Playstation 4. Designed for hardcore players, this unpredictable and deadly mod tries to bring realism into the post-apocalypse. AI routines have changed depending on the enemy group, with human mercenaries fighting carefully from cover while Super Mutants use their enhanced strength to charge wildly. Monsters are fierce, and humans are deadly.

The player begins with only 20 HP, and gun damage is calculated by caliber. Ammunition has weight, can be crafted and melee attacks are deadlier than before. On top of all those changes, you'll also find a stack of gear under your pre-war bed. This mod changes how you'll play from the start, so it's recommended you begin a new game from scratch before activating it.

There's also a version designed for DLC — with changes made to new content only found in Automatron, Nuka-World and Far Harbor.

Outfield Retreat

  • Author: TheRealElianora
  • Download Size: 298.23 KB
  • DLC Required: None

This brand-new player house was created, in the author's own words, to 'shut the mouths of people constantly grieving that 'PS4 MODS WILL SUCK!'. In any case, this Diamond City housing doesn't suck. Carefully designed for maximum comfort (and Feng Shui), this impressive bit of modelling includes all the simple things a Sole Survivor needs to relax between quests.

The small space contains a map marker for fast travel, a workstation, bobblehead shelf, unique storage cases, clean water, a fancy bed, and plenty of bookshelves you can use. The decorations, though, can't be altered. This house isn't for players looking to display everything they own, or to customize — this is for the laid back adventurer that wants a nice place away from the hustle-bustle of settlements that's pre-made. There's even a day-night cycle.

Plenty ‘O' Exploration

  • Author: DangoSan
  • Download Size: 531.67 KB
  • DLC Required: None

[Note: This mod is still in development, and will see new content updates in the near future.]

This mod may only be in BETA for PS4, it includes something every Fallout fan should enjoy — plenty of new interiors and exteriors to explore. As explained in the description, most of the new interiors can be found in the Concord area, which is sadly underutilized in the main portion of the game. This simple mod adds nine new interiors to the mix, fully explorable and completely immersive. Like any good mod, these locations look like they belong in the main game.

Then there's the exteriors. There are multiple haunts, huts, and retreats to stumble into as you progress through the northern reaches of the Commonwealth. If you felt like Fallout 4 didn't have enough locations, both inside or out, then this is a great mod to get started on.

There are more mods that are compatible — combine them for even more extra locations to explore.

Mix and match to truly expand the Commonwealth into a bustling area with endless exploration options.

A Cannibal in Concord

  • Author: T9x69
  • Download Size: 442.67 KB
  • DLC Required: None

Speaking of additional Concord content, this puzzle-based atmospheric exploration mod sends your Sole Survivor on an ambient quest deep into the mind of a maniac. Featuring short stories and quotes meant to completely creep you out, this spooky house is designed for a solo trip for maximum spook-factor. This addition isn't about running-and-gunning, or even a traditional quest structure.

If you're looking for an interesting place to puzzle over that's filled with creepy visuals, this is one of the best mods available on the PS4. Don't worry that your companion won't go inside the house with you — that's by design.

Portable Nuka Jetpack

  • Author: langnao
  • Download Size: 18.33 KB
  • DLC Required: Nuka-World

Want to go flying, but don't want that bulky Power Armor? If you have the Nuka-World DLC, you can take to the skies with this amazing jetpack, available for free in the Super Duper Mart. This is a quick solution, and doesn't require access to one of those tricky Power Armor upgrades. There's no fall damage, the suit comes with ballistic weave, and the included helmet helps deal with radiation.

If you're not so fond of the Nuka-World outfit this jetpack comes with, try out the incredibly useful Unified Clothing Overhaul Mod by ANDREWCX, also featured in this article below. His mod adds tons of useful features to clothing crafting, and unlocks the jetpack for Nuka-World owners.

  • Author: ANDREWCX
  • Download Size: 514.85 KB
  • DLC Required: None / Automatron + Nuka-World + Far Harbor [Two versions of the mod are available.]

Not satisfied with weapon customization in Fallout 4? Here's a mod that gives you plenty of tools to expand your arsenal, effectively allowing you to create insane franken-guns using every part from almost every weapon. The mod removes perk requirements and material costs so you can freely experiment to make the wild weapon of your dreams.

And there are limitations. Not every gun part fits to every other gun part — the mod doesn't alter models, animations, or stats of these weapons, and does not include melee weapons. This is about guns only. What makes this mod special is the creative way it wants to get around the obvious drawbacks of PS4 modding. This is a development tool, better for creating cool custom weapons than for day-to-day play. The author recommends finishing your awesome assets, then disabling the mod when you're finished. Here's hoping this mod helps future authors create new weapons on the PS4.

World to Come

  • Author: Neeher
  • Download Size: 973.35 KB
  • DLC Required: None

Fight the ultimate beast on the PS4 in 'World to Come' a mini-quest mod challenging any Sole Survival to beat Gojira, a huge (and fast) legendary Death Claw. And we're not talking normal huge here, this thing is six times the size of a regular Death Claw. It's well over two-stories tall, and the health bar is equally impressive. Defeating it will earn you a brand new Perk.

To start the quest, find a man between Quincy Quarries and Hyde Park in the Commonwealth. He'll point you in the right direction. Just remember to go prepared.

Survival in Fallout 4 is a difficulty mode.

Survival Information


The following is a list of changes experienced in Survival Mode:

Saving


  • Manual and quicksaving are disabled. To save your game, you'll need to find a bed and sleep for at least an hour.

Combat


  • Combat is more lethal for everyone. You now deal, but also take, more damage. You can increase the damage you deal even further with 'Adrenaline' (see below).

Fast Travel


  • Fast Travel is disabled. If you wish to be somewhere, you'll have to physically travel there.

Weighted Ammo


  • Bullets and shells now all have a small amount of weight, which varies by caliber. Heavier items such as fusion cores, rockets, and mini-nukes can really drag you down.

Compass


  • Be sure to keep your eyes peeled, as enemies will no longer appear on your compass. As well, the distance at which locations of interest will appear has been significantly shortened.

Adrenaline


  • Survival automatically grants the Adrenaline perk, which provides a bonus to your damage output. Unlike other perks, the only way to increase your rank of the Adrenaline perk is by getting kills (hostile or otherwise). The higher your Adrenaline rank, the higher the damage bonus. Sleeping for more than an hour, however, will cause your Adrenaline rank to lower. You can check your current Adrenaline rank at any time in the Perks section on the Stat tab in your Pip-Boy.

Wellness


  • You'll find it difficult to survive without taking proper care of yourself. You must stay hydrated, fed, and rested to remain combat-ready. Going for extended periods of time without food, water, or sleep will begin to adversely affect your health, hurting your SPECIAL stats, adding to your Fatigue (see 'Fatigue' below), lowering your immunity (see 'Sickness' below), and eventually even dealing physical damage to you.

Fatigue


  • Fatigue works like radiation but affects your Action Points (AP) rather than your Hit Points (HP). The more Fatigue you've built up, the less AP you'll have for other actions. The amount of Fatigue you've accumulated is displayed in red on your AP bar.

Sickness


  • A comprised immune system and a few questionable decisions can end up getting you killed. Eating uncooked meat, drinking unpurified water, taking damage from disease-ridden sources, such as ghouls and bugs, or using harmful Chems all put your body at increased risk for various ill effects. When you are afflicted with an illness, a message will appear onscreen. You can view specifics about your current illnesses by navigating to the Status section on your Pip-Boy's Data tab and pressing [RShoulder] to view your active effects.

Antibiotics


  • Antibiotics, which can be crafted at Chem Stations or purchased from doctors, heal the various effects of sickness.
